Sullen TV presents an inside look behind the work of tattoo artist Josh Hagan in this latest episode of Portfolio Peek. Hagan is best known for his color realism, though he works equally well in black and grey. Though his clientele mainly seeks Hagan out for his incredible portraiture, Hagan’s preferred subject matter is aliens. So take a look at this video here to see some gorgeous portraiture and alien tattoos that are out of this world. You’ll also get to see what kinds of “doohickies” and “doodads” Hagan likes to spice up his portfolio with.
